Where BC3150 fits in TDS blowdown control
BC3150 is the model route for steam boiler projects that need automatic
control of boiler water TDS without adding bottom blowdown timing or Modbus
communications to the same controller. It monitors conductivity, compares the
reading with the setpoint and drives the blowdown valve to keep dissolved
solids within the target range.
The controller is typically used with CP10, CP30 or CP32 conductivity
probes and can also work in contaminated condensate monitoring arrangements
where conductivity is used to decide whether condensate should be diverted.
Typical duties and selection intent
BC3150 is a practical fit when the project needs to:
- automate continuous boiler TDS blowdown
- reduce reliance on manual blowdown routines
- use
4-20 mA output for local monitoring or wider plant visibility - add temperature compensation with a
Pt100 input where conditions vary - use pulse blowdown on smaller boilers to reduce water-level disturbance
If the immediate requirement includes bottom blowdown timing, trend display or
RS485 / Modbus RTU, compare the
BC3250 boiler blowdown controller.
Capabilities confirmed by current documentation
Current documentation confirms support for automatic TDS control, flushing,
sensor cleaning output, 4-20 mA output and infrared communication. It also
documents panel, DIN rail or backplate mounting for indoor control panels or
suitable enclosures.
Before specification, confirm the conductivity probe type, probe mounting
position, whether temperature compensation is required, the blowdown valve
package and how the output signal will be used by the site.
